摘要
The paper refers to a new composition of Metalworking Fluids (MWF) for reduction of friction, friction and abrasion between cutter and machined metal, remove heat generated and prevent corrosion of machined parts. Metalworking fluids are used to assist machining operations. The products originally used were based on mineral oils and which contained a large amount of aromatic oils subsequently proved to be carcinogenic and causing respiratory diseases. The problem solved by this new composition of Metalworking Fluids (MWF)consists in providing qualitative and quantitative ratios between the component elements that allow for a composition between the constituents of the composition for cooling and anticorrosive protection to obtain very stable emulsions with optimal lubricating properties and at the same time protective corrosion.
